Backports Mesa main's unconditional flip of VK_EXT_legacy_dithering. Pure-software composition; no new HW path. vk_render_pass already gates on enabled_features.legacyDithering and panvk_vX_blend + pan_format already plumb the dithered BLEND descriptor (BFMT2 table has MALI_BLEND_AU encodings for RGB565/RGB5A1/RGBA4/RGB10A2 on PAN_ARCH 7). Our r5 base just hadn't picked up the cherry-pick. Phase 7 verify on ohm (PineTab2 / RK3566 / Mali-G52 r1 MC1) with a locally-built r6 lib at /tmp/r6_test_lib/: Feature advertisement: r5: VK_EXT_legacy_dithering not in extension list, legacyDithering=false r6: VK_EXT_legacy_dithering rev 2 advertised, legacyDithering=true dEQP subsets (delta): dEQP-VK.api.*.legacy_dithering* r5/r6 both: 2 P / 0 F (identical) dEQP-VK.renderpass.dithering.* r5/r6 both: 0 P / 0 F / 94 NS (identical) dEQP-VK.renderpass2.dithering.* r5/r6 both: 0 P / 0 F / 94 NS (identical) Net: zero regressions, advertisement-only delta as expected. Second-model review (per bugfix-process step 4) traced the full code path through vk_render_pass + panvk_vX_cmd_draw + panvk_vX_blend + pan_format BFMT2. No interaction with our r1 nullDescriptor (disjoint paths). Mesa upstream marks ext DONE for panvk in docs/features.txt. ARM's own libmali r51p0 driver (BXODROIDN2PL, 2024-08) lists VK_EXT_legacy_dithering in its Vulkan extension string table, confirming the feature is shipped by ARM for Mali-G52-class hardware. Follow-up out of scope: the 94 renderpass-dithering tests show as NotSupported on both r5 and r6 — there's a separate panvk-side prereq the dEQP harness checks (likely a specific format-feature combination).
